What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
- Oversee and provide training for TSS staff in CBRN tactics, techniques, and procedures
- Manage the CDL Drug testing program and all CDL training and renewals
- Maintain records of TSS training and documentation for federal government compliance
- Support and document monthly drills for TSSs using CBRN detection equipment
- Facilitate operational communications and maintain communication equipment
What is Required (Qualifications):
- Active Secret security clearance or higher
- Minimum of 5 years experience in radiological and nuclear detection and training
- Experience in chemical, biological, radiological, and nuclear detection training
- Must have a Class B CDL license or ability to obtain one within 3 months of hire
- Ability to travel up to 75% of the month within the contiguous United States
How to Stand Out (Preferred Qualifications):
- Special event operational experience including SEAR or NSSE events
- Knowledgeable in using Mobile/Portable Radiation Detection Systems and related equipment
- Experience working with radioactive materials and radiation worker training

Parsons Corporation is an American technology-focused defense, intelligence, security, and infrastructure engineering firm headquartered in Centreville, Virginia.
